zoukankan      html  css  js  c++  java
  • c# 调用浏览器打开网址

     string liulanqi = ""; ;
                try
                {
                    //从注册表中读取默认浏览器可执行文件路径
                    var key = Microsoft.Win32.Registry.ClassesRoot.OpenSubKey(@"httpshellopencommand");
                    string s = key.GetValue("").ToString();
                    //s就是你的默认浏览器,不过后面带了参数,把它截去,不过需要注意的是:不同的浏览器后面的参数不一样!
                    //"D:Program Files (x86)GoogleChromeApplicationchrome.exe" -- "%1"
                    liulanqi = s.Substring(1, s.Length - 10);
                }
                catch{}
                if (string.IsNullOrWhiteSpace(liulanqi))
                    liulanqi = "iexplore.exe";
                var urlData = "www.baidu.com";
                string url = string.Format("{0}'{1}'", urlData.G_Remark, _AttrCustomer["C_ID"].ToString());
                if(!File.Exists(liulanqi))
                {
                    liulanqi = "iexplore.exe";
                }
                System.Diagnostics.Process.Start(liulanqi, url);
  • 相关阅读:
    5059 一起去打CS
    2439 降雨量
    vijos P1037搭建双塔
    4979 数塔
    2596 售货员的难题
    P2342 叠积木
    1540 银河英雄传说
    1051 接龙游戏
    hdu1251
    洛谷P1717 钓鱼
  • 原文地址:https://www.cnblogs.com/shuaimeng/p/15357724.html
Copyright © 2011-2022 走看看